You are going to have to unzip the file. then you go into the sub-directory of “Web” -> “mygame” ->“scenes”

Hey JackS,
In case you’re still struggling, you need to go to \dfabulich-choicescript-515e4ef\web\mygame\scenes, where you’ll find files like startup.txt and choicescript_stats.txt (these two files are vital, you can delete all the other files if you wish).

These .txt files are where you write your story. To edit these files, you need a text editor - on windows by default there is a program called “Notepad” and on Mac by default the program is “Text Edit”. (There are better text editors you can download though.) You can’t use Word or Adobe Reader. If you’re on windows and want these types of files to always open in your text editor, right-click one of the files, go to properties and change “opens with” to your text editor. There’s a similar process you can do on Mac (I think it’s under “Get info” or something).

Then to test your game out, you need to open index.html (in the \dfabulich-choicescript-515e4ef\web\mygame\ folder) in Firefox.

There’s a good tutorial about all this on the wiki as well.
